Biostatistician II – Structured Job Description

Location: Bangalore
Category: Clinical
Job ID: 252245


🔹 Summary of Responsibilities

1. Statistical Leadership (Simple Studies)

  • Serve as Lead Biostatistician on simple clinical studies.

  • Provide statistical oversight and actively participate in project meetings.

  • Communicate project status, tasks, and budget awareness to line managers and project managers.

2. Statistical Planning

  • Prepare Statistical Analysis Plans (SAPs), including:

    • Mock Table, Figure, Listing (TFL) shells

    • For simple and medium-complexity studies

  • Work under supervision of senior biostatisticians.

3. Statistical Analysis

  • Perform statistical analyses for medium-complexity clinical studies.

  • Conduct detailed statistical review of TFLs before client delivery.

4. Study Documentation & Review

  • Review:

    • Case Report Forms (CRFs)

    • Study-specific plans and specifications

  • Contribute statistical input to Clinical Study Reports (CSR) for simple studies.

5. Randomization & Sample Size

  • Generate and review randomization schedules under senior supervision.

  • Perform sample size calculations (primarily for Clinical Pharmacology studies) under guidance.

6. Additional Activities

  • Perform all other assigned statistical or documentation tasks as required.


Minimum Qualifications

  • Master’s degree (or equivalent) in Biostatistics or related field.


Required Experience (3–5 Years)

  • 3–5 years of relevant experience or equivalent combination of education and experience.

  • Ability to program in at least one statistical software package (SAS® preferred).

  • Strong communication skills for explaining statistical concepts.
